Manic Street Preachers have released a video for Hold Me Like A Heaven.
It’s the latest single to be unveiled from the Welsh rock legends’ recent LP, ‘Resistance is Futile’. Discussing it, bassist Nicky Wire said:
“This track sprung from reading Lines on a Young Lady’s Photograph Album by Phillip Larkin, and his poem Aubade as well. It was the last lyric written for the record and I knew it had to be special.
"It’s got one of my favourite ever lines, which is “what is the future of the future/when memory fades and gets boarded up”. We’ve long been obsessed with writing something like Ashes to Ashes; I think this is the closest we’ll ever get.”
